How to access and apply our formatting colors

  1. Using global highlights as an example, click on the row edit cog icon to access the row edit menu that contains options for global highlights 

2. You can click on any of the first 9 “base” colors, or click on the arrow to the right of the purple circle to access the new shades

As always, you can also use the Shift + CMD + G (Shift + CTRL + G on Windows) to cycle through the base colors for quickly adding new global highlights.
